Carolina Panthers officially place QB Sam Darnold on injured reserve with shoulder injury

An MRI this week revealed Darnold had an incomplete fracture of the scapula on his right (throwing) shoulder. The injury is believed to have occurred in Sunday’s 24-6 loss to the New England Patriots.
